Lagos State Governor, Babajide Sanwo-Olu, was recently confirmed in office by the Supreme Court. This historic decision strengthened the governor’s confidence in the country’s justice system. In this article, we explore Sanwo-Olu’s inclusive approach to governance and examine how his victory is not just about him and his deputy, but also about all the people of Lagos State.

Inclusive leadership:
Since assuming office in May 2019, Governor Sanwo-Olu has adopted a governance approach that is respectful of all citizens of Lagos State. In his acceptance speech after the election, he emphasized that there was no winner or loser. This desire for inclusiveness is manifested in its policies and decisions, which aim to improve the lives of all residents of the state.
